Bridge Maintenance, July 5th to July 7th

Seattle Department of Transportation (SDOT) crews plan to perform maintenance work on several bridges next week, listed below. This work is subject to change in the event that crews are called to another location for emergency work.

July 5
West Seattle Bridge
Crews will close the eastbound, right curb lane just east of the Andover pedestrian bridge from 8 a.m. to 3 p.m. while they repair a rail that was damaged in an accident.

July 6
4th Avenue South, from Weller to Airport Way
Crews will keep at least one lane in each direction open while they repair expansion joints between 9 a.m. and 3 p.m.

July 6
8th Avenue NW and NW 130th Street
Traffic flaggers will assist traffic through from 8 a.m. to 3 p.m. while engineers inspect the bridge.

July 6
Klickitat Overpass on Harbor Island
The northbound, right curb lane will be closed from 8 a.m. to 3 p.m. while crews repair a pedestrian guard rail.

July 7
Emerson Street Viaduct Bridge to Nickerson Street, eastbound ramp
Traffic flaggers will assist traffic through from 9 a.m. to 3 p.m. while crews repair expansion joints on the bridge.
